摘要
随着工业生产中能源利用效率的提升需求日益增长,蒸汽冷凝水的闪蒸再利用成为节能减排的重要途径。本文围绕蒸汽冷凝水闪蒸再利用过程中的自动化控制技术展开,设计并研发了一套高效智能控制装置。该装置实现了对闪蒸过程的实时监测与调节,优化能量回收效率,降低运行成本,提升系统稳定性和安全性。实验结果表明,自动化控制装置能够显著提高蒸汽冷凝水的利用率,推动工业节能技术的应用和推广。
Abstract
As the demand for improving energy efficiency in industrial production grows, the flash evaporation and reuse of steam condensate has become a crucial method for energy conservation and emission reduction. This paper focuses on the automation control technology used in the flash evaporation and reuse of steam condensate, designing and developing an efficient intelligent control system. This system enables real-time monitoring and adjustment of the flash evaporation process, optimizing energy recovery efficiency, reducing operating costs, and enhancing system stability and safety. Experimental results show that the automated control system significantly improves the utilization rate of steam condensate, promoting the application and dissemination of industrial energy-saving technologies.
